diff --git a/built_packages b/built_packages index 19f31b6d..4833b789 100755 --- a/built_packages +++ b/built_packages @@ -1,8 +1,8 @@ https://github.com/ament/ament_cmake.git 17d4da4f62233eea92c29a897b1a9ba4cc919979 -https://github.com/ament/ament_index.git f3b6ddc6698cff22b8724136188df5d9912ced78 -https://github.com/ament/ament_lint.git 20a32b7835c779f1bef96ef3dfd66dfbef2ce1cc -https://github.com/ament/ament_package.git 797ecde6090689ebe0d84b6620f7bf4c972a8232 +https://github.com/ament/ament_index.git 13b1378907f80485c8fe481d16f5b34a89de9ae8 +https://github.com/ament/ament_lint.git 6353c1b4ef0c5f3bdd0008f95f4a269ebd696609 +https://github.com/ament/ament_package.git 7bc761265d7c665334708682e5a8f3e91cb9f039 https://github.com/ament/googletest.git bee0ad5f9bc5796fe1cb34484cb0adc13ec7c032 https://github.com/ament/uncrustify_vendor.git a2a8e43c8bdd70f1005443f89f2e2c531cb493ab https://github.com/eProsima/Micro-CDR.git ed4fd513a24a53b93d548d342cb7aa0a18716f04 @@ -15,22 +15,22 @@ https://github.com/micro-ROS/rmw-microxrcedds.git b6e02669d42fd5aeddc1e5b71bac65 https://github.com/micro-ROS/rosidl_typesupport.git 16c7df67d3b5aa5615332ef702a5da156d6b95cc https://github.com/micro-ROS/rosidl_typesupport_microxrcedds.git dd85753ac26ba136ddf35867c5484cbe90b68714 https://github.com/ros-controls/control_msgs 1416954c31432c192ff95a06559847e87386cf60 -https://github.com/ros2/ament_cmake_ros.git 3009543775aa483595ef488d9dbefa28d181b520 -https://github.com/ros2/common_interfaces.git a2ef867438e6d4eed074d6e3668ae45187e7de86 +https://github.com/ros2/ament_cmake_ros.git 232937e03dd816d042dc75dc872827342cb3d931 +https://github.com/ros2/common_interfaces.git e8256c0f37927bd5f0b5ac42a3282e7543a9d034 https://github.com/ros2/example_interfaces.git e4f46c5762e433a72b2496bb23b0375ecfc06d1e https://github.com/ros2/libyaml_vendor.git c69b99721471d47f88042b44e510cfefafb385b9 -https://github.com/ros2/rcl.git b4e6e140bc2209ce01d8d47a77393e8549133020 -https://github.com/ros2/rcl_interfaces.git 57418190b34436b3ae6339a169b50defaaebe903 +https://github.com/ros2/rcl.git 4af269ffd487bb24c99aae6246296f3b9376f13c +https://github.com/ros2/rcl_interfaces.git 1bd7d0b36c79e9e6db6980301f3732fff51ddc50 https://github.com/ros2/rcl_logging.git 2632df5bd77e2414169b5e2d61e6322cb363119b https://github.com/ros2/rclc 74acd42f850d8b2ebc647ae1c326d871fdddf1b3 https://github.com/ros2/rcpputils.git 37a8801c18632d7d725ff1659248e8b12a7f2089 https://github.com/ros2/rmw.git e6addf2411b8ee8a2ac43d691533b8c05ae8f1b6 -https://github.com/ros2/rmw_implementation.git 4dd5d571a5bfa1a67183acf271dfa442932c7572 -https://github.com/ros2/ros2_tracing.git 526967c1a0ad3208fe6c28e0cf16f2b045ed5241 -https://github.com/ros2/rosidl.git 4e30600ea550b8ba72d016570c60eba0df5d094a +https://github.com/ros2/rmw_implementation.git f2989ebe617679effe9c0e032415821435532c65 +https://github.com/ros2/ros2_tracing.git d373a61c90a3ad3a4a833e46679bb736d4952746 +https://github.com/ros2/rosidl.git eedfa01db9c8039432a6ce58bb89427006a2ea0b https://github.com/ros2/rosidl_core.git c3fd5020611374d6ab2f7e9a540ecf86f3c1615e https://github.com/ros2/rosidl_dds.git 772632eb729ab48f368a0862659224be80caf56b https://github.com/ros2/rosidl_defaults.git 1c730458cbee50e2941f67e441e0fd5a3d3c7e6b https://github.com/ros2/rosidl_dynamic_typesupport.git 7f3466266dd11baf29d3b2d82ee22c93104d7675 https://github.com/ros2/test_interface_files.git a565a8927962e5bcbd5667b884a0f0652568c177 -https://github.com/ros2/unique_identifier_msgs.git b17c29fcc3d584bd834dbc422e763c1235e315e9 +https://github.com/ros2/unique_identifier_msgs.git b4779af6b3d3c45e710802a0e7f86113da281ae8 diff --git a/src/cortex-m0plus/libmicroros.a b/src/cortex-m0plus/libmicroros.a index 1e2f8831..7454049e 100755 Binary files a/src/cortex-m0plus/libmicroros.a and b/src/cortex-m0plus/libmicroros.a differ diff --git a/src/cortex-m3/libmicroros.a b/src/cortex-m3/libmicroros.a index efd8ff38..b2d72b5c 100755 Binary files a/src/cortex-m3/libmicroros.a and b/src/cortex-m3/libmicroros.a differ diff --git a/src/cortex-m4/libmicroros.a b/src/cortex-m4/libmicroros.a index 4570df4a..3af10b7d 100755 Binary files a/src/cortex-m4/libmicroros.a and b/src/cortex-m4/libmicroros.a differ diff --git a/src/cortex-m7/fpv5-d16-softfp/libmicroros.a b/src/cortex-m7/fpv5-d16-softfp/libmicroros.a index ae059105..7f90fc4c 100755 Binary files a/src/cortex-m7/fpv5-d16-softfp/libmicroros.a and b/src/cortex-m7/fpv5-d16-softfp/libmicroros.a differ diff --git a/src/cortex-m7/fpv5-sp-d16-hardfp/libmicroros.a b/src/cortex-m7/fpv5-sp-d16-hardfp/libmicroros.a index 815a48d2..c6606c03 100755 Binary files a/src/cortex-m7/fpv5-sp-d16-hardfp/libmicroros.a and b/src/cortex-m7/fpv5-sp-d16-hardfp/libmicroros.a differ diff --git a/src/cortex-m7/fpv5-sp-d16-softfp/libmicroros.a b/src/cortex-m7/fpv5-sp-d16-softfp/libmicroros.a index fb5c7ab7..a681b865 100755 Binary files a/src/cortex-m7/fpv5-sp-d16-softfp/libmicroros.a and b/src/cortex-m7/fpv5-sp-d16-softfp/libmicroros.a differ diff --git a/src/esp32/libmicroros.a b/src/esp32/libmicroros.a index 02c0ec10..c323a0f0 100755 Binary files a/src/esp32/libmicroros.a and b/src/esp32/libmicroros.a differ diff --git a/src/tracetools/tracetools.h b/src/tracetools/tracetools.h index eab8016b..44063095 100755 --- a/src/tracetools/tracetools.h +++ b/src/tracetools/tracetools.h @@ -142,6 +142,12 @@ extern "C" */ TRACETOOLS_PUBLIC bool ros_trace_compile_status(void); +/// Get tracing runtime status. +/** + * \return `true` if tracing is enabled, `false` otherwise + */ +TRACETOOLS_PUBLIC bool ros_trace_runtime_status(void); + /// `rcl_init` /** * Initialisation for the whole process.